The Issue
The Philippines, an archipelago blessed with breathtaking coastlines and vibrant marine life, faces a critical juncture. Our marine treasures, once teeming with life, are under threat. From coral reefs bleached by warming waters to fish stocks depleted by overfishing, the health of our oceans is in decline. But hope remains. "Coast of Hope: Reviving Our Marine Treasures" is a call to action, a rallying cry to protect and restore the lifeblood of our islands.
The clock is ticking, and the situation is dire. We cannot afford to wait any longer. The time to act to protect our marine ecosystems is now. Our oceans, the lifeblood of our planet, are in crisis. Overfishing, pollution, and climate change are wreaking havoc, threatening not only marine life but also the livelihoods of coastal communities and the very health of our planet.
